Method of controlling density in gas-sensitized aqueous explosives

The sensitization of an aqueous explosive is described by homogeneously mixing a gas into an explosive stream in a mixing zone. The components of the explosive are intermixed to form a continuous stream, one of the components being a gas-retaining component. The portion of the stream containing the gas-retaining component is passed through a mixing zone across which there is a pressure drop of at least 5 psi. The gas added to the mixing zone and is homogeneously dispersed into the stream. (14 claims)
